The global demand for renewable natural gas (RNG), also known as biomethane, is on the rise. RNG is a sustainable energy source alternative to fossil fuels, produced from organic waste. It plays a crucial role in reducing the carbon footprint of the natural gas grid and transportation. The expansion of this industry thrives on government incentives and regulations designed to curb greenhouse gas emissions. This upward industry trend is expected to continue in the coming years.

RNG production involves capturing and processing methane emissions produced by organic matter from various sources, including landfills, wastewater treatment plants, and feedstock operations. Through processes like anaerobic digestion, the captured methane is upgraded to meet quality standards and transformed into RNG. This process mitigates the environmental impact of methane and creates a renewable energy source.
This sustainable fuel can be used on-site as part of a self-sufficient energy system or transported through natural gas pipelines for use in other locations. Its applications include heating, generating electricity and serving as a fuel source for vehicles, among other uses.
